Widow of Alvin principal who died of COVID rejects school named for him, cites 'lack of respect' when he was alive

Amy Castro, widow of Alvin Junior High School principal LeRoy Castro, who died of COVID in November 2020, holds a photo of her husband in Alvin, Texas.The wife of an Alvin ISD principal who died from COVID-19 told the district this week his family does not want her late husband’s name on a new middle school because she said the school system “did not honor him in life.”

“Before being hospitalized on Oct. 12, , LeRoy believed his life insurance was in place because premiums had been deducted from three paychecks by then,” Mary Castro said during public comment at Tuesday’s board meeting. “Sadly, he was wrong.” “The harm that the district has caused my family and the lack of respect shown to my husband is why we don’t want his name affiliated with the district,” she said.The district did not immediately respond to a request for comment Friday.
